The term “energy transition” is suddenly everywhere—from newsfeeds to policies.

At its essence, the clean energy shift is the global move from legacy energy inputs to cleaner alternatives such as sun-powered, wind, water-generated, biomass, green hydrogen, and earth-heat power. But this transformation is more than just trading coal for sun — it's a complete reengineering of how we power our entire world.

The Tools Powering the Transition

Photovoltaic and turbine energy headline the change, but they’re just part of the story. Energy containment systems like grid-scale storage manage fluctuations in a renewable-heavy grid.

Hydrogen from renewable sources is a rising contender — particularly for hard-to-electrify industries such as heavy logistics. Though not yet mainstream, it presents a revolutionary alternative for decarbonised power.
